President Muhammadu Buhari has arrived in Maiduguri, Borno State capital on a one-day official visit to inaugurate a 50-Megawatts Power Plant and other viable projects executed by the state government.
The presidential jet landed at the Nigerian Air Force wing of the Maiduguri International Airport on Thursday at about 11.10 a.m and Buhari was received on arrival by Governor Babagana Zulum, members of the National and State Houses of Assembly, and some top government officials.
Other dignitaries that received the President were the Theatre Commander, North East Operation Hadin (OPHK), Maj.- Gen. Ibrahim Ali, Heads of security agencies, and community and religious leaders.
President Buhari is expected to inaugurate the new 50 megawatts Maiduguri Gas Power plant constructed by the Nigeria National Petroleum Company Limited (NNPC), NAN reports.
He will also commission the Ahmadu Bello Way, Shehu Sanda Kyari, Lafiya and Mogoram Roads, before proceeding to the Maiduguri Monday Market gutted by fire recently.
Buhari would be conducted round the scene by the General Manager of the market, Mustapha Loskorima.
